Position Overview

The MDS Coordinator is responsible for ensuring the accurate and timely completion of MDS assessments in accordance with state and federal regulations. This individual will work closely with nursing, therapy, social services, and facility leadership to support quality resident care, maintain compliance, and maximize reimbursement opportunities.

Key Responsibilities

  • Complete and submit MDS assessments accurately and within required timeframes

  •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and facility regulations related to the MDS process

  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to gather clinical information and support comprehensive resident assessments

  • Participate in the development and implementation of individualized care plans

  • Monitor reimbursement opportunities and ensure appropriate documentation to support case mix and Medicare/Medicaid requirements

  • Conduct audits and review documentation for accuracy and compliance

  • Provide education and guidance to nursing and interdisciplinary staff regarding MDS requirements and documentation standards

  • Stay current on changes to MDS regulations, reimbursement methodologies, and industry best practices

Qualifications

  • Active New York Registered Nurse (RN) license required

  • Minimum of 1 year of experience as an MDS Coordinator in a skilled nursing facility or long-term care setting

  • Strong knowledge of the RAI process, MDS completion, care planning, and reimbursement systems

  • Thorough understanding of Medicare and Medicaid regulations

  • Experience working with SigmaCare preferred

  • Excellent organizational, communication, and leadership skills

  • Strong attention to detail and ability to manage multiple deadlines
